What happens if a Shinigami falls in love with a human?
If a Shinigami falls in love with a human in Death Note, they risk their own existence because they are meant to take lives, not save them; the ultimate consequence is that if they use their Death Note to prevent the human's death, the Shinigami dies, their remaining lifespan transferring to the human, as seen with Gelus dying for Misa Amane. Shinigami (Japanese: 死神, lit. 'kami of death') are kami that invite humans toward death in certain aspects of Japanese religion and culture. Shinigami have been described as monsters, helpers, and creatures of darkness.What does Ryuk love?
Ryuk has a great fondness for apples, stating the addiction to be an equivalent of cigarettes and alcohol for humans. Shinigami apples are withered and taste like sand, as he shows Misa at one point, which is why he prefers apples from the human world.What do soulmates feel like?
